Choosing the Right ERP System: A Comprehensive Guide for Businesses
Selecting the right Enterprise Resource Planning (ERP) system is a critical decision for any business. An ERP system integrates various business functions—such as finance, human resources, procurement, and supply chain—into one centralized platform. When implemented effectively, it can streamline processes, improve decision-making, and boost efficiency. However, with a wide range of ERP solutions available, choosing the right one can be challenging. This guide will walk you through key considerations and steps to help you make an informed decision.
1. Assess Your Business Needs
Before selecting an ERP system, you need a clear understanding of your organization’s specific requirements. Consider the following:
- Business Size: Are you a small business, a mid-sized enterprise, or a large corporation? Some ERP solutions are tailored for specific company sizes.
- Industry Requirements: Different industries have unique needs. For example, manufacturing firms require ERP systems that handle production and inventory management, while service-based companies may prioritize project management and customer relationship tools.
- Business Processes: Identify the core processes that need integration, such as accounting, inventory management, or human resources. This will guide your choice of an ERP system with the right functionalities.
2. Cloud vs. On-Premise ERP
One of the most important decisions is whether to choose a cloud-based ERP or an on-premise solution:
- Cloud-Based ERP: Hosted on the vendor’s servers and accessed via the internet, cloud ERP systems are known for their scalability, flexibility, and lower upfront costs. They are ideal for businesses seeking rapid deployment, lower IT infrastructure investment, and remote accessibility.
- On-Premise ERP: This traditional model involves hosting the system on your company’s own servers. While it offers more control and customization, on-premise ERP systems require significant upfront costs and ongoing maintenance. It may suit larger organizations with robust IT resources or those that prioritize data control.
3. Evaluate Core Features and Functionalities
When choosing an ERP system, it’s essential to ensure it has the capabilities to support your key business processes. Look for the following core features:
- Financial Management: The ERP should manage general ledger, accounts payable/receivable, budgeting, and financial reporting.
- Inventory and Supply Chain Management: If you handle physical products, the ERP must track inventory, manage procurement, and optimize the supply chain.
- Human Resources (HR) Management: Look for features such as payroll, employee records, and talent management.
- Customer Relationship Management (CRM): For businesses that prioritize sales and marketing, integrated CRM tools can help manage customer data and improve engagement.
- Analytics and Reporting: Robust reporting tools and dashboards are essential for data-driven decision-making.
4. Consider Customization and Scalability
Your business is likely to grow and evolve, so it’s crucial to select an ERP system that can scale with your needs:
- Customization: Some ERP systems offer built-in flexibility to adapt to your specific processes, workflows, or industry needs. While customization can improve alignment with your operations, excessive customization can make upgrades and maintenance more complex and costly.
- Scalability: As your business expands, you may need to add new users, features, or even integrate additional business units. Ensure the ERP system you choose is scalable enough to accommodate future growth without requiring a full system overhaul.
5. Vendor Reputation and Support
Choosing the right ERP vendor is just as important as selecting the system itself. Consider the following when evaluating vendors:
- Reputation and Expertise: Look for a vendor with a proven track record of successful ERP implementations in your industry. Read reviews, request references, and assess their industry-specific experience.
- Support and Training: ERP implementation can be complex, so reliable customer support is critical. Ensure the vendor offers comprehensive training for your staff, as well as ongoing support and updates.
- Partnership Approach: The vendor should act as a partner, not just a provider. They should be willing to collaborate on implementation strategies and post-implementation improvements.
6. Budget and Total Cost of Ownership (TCO)
ERP systems represent a significant investment, so it’s important to understand the full scope of costs:
- Initial Costs: This includes licensing fees (for on-premise systems) or subscription costs (for cloud-based ERP), along with implementation costs such as setup, data migration, and employee training.
- Ongoing Costs: Consider the long-term costs such as software upgrades, maintenance, and additional user licenses.
- TCO Calculation: Don’t just focus on the initial price. Calculate the total cost of ownership over the system’s lifetime (usually 5-10 years) to determine if it fits your budget.
7. Integration Capabilities
Your ERP system needs to integrate with other software tools your business uses, such as:
- CRM Systems
- E-commerce Platforms
- Payroll Systems
- Marketing Automation Tools
Seamless integration ensures that data flows smoothly across different departments and systems, reducing redundancy and manual data entry errors. Ask the vendor about integration APIs and compatibility with your existing systems.
8. Security and Compliance
ERP systems manage sensitive business data, making security a top priority:
- Data Security: Ensure the ERP system has robust security protocols, including encryption, user authentication, and regular security updates.
- Compliance: Depending on your industry, the ERP may need to comply with specific regulations, such as GDPR (for data privacy) or SOX (for financial reporting).
Cloud-based ERP vendors often provide advanced security measures, but it’s essential to evaluate their data protection policies and compliance certifications.
9. Implementation Process
The success of your ERP implementation depends on proper planning and execution:
- Implementation Timeline: Understand the projected timeline for implementation. A rushed deployment can lead to poor adoption, while a well-planned rollout allows for thorough testing and training.
- Phased vs. Big Bang Approach: Decide whether to roll out the ERP in phases (starting with key functions) or implement the entire system at once. The phased approach may reduce risk and allow gradual adoption.
10. Post-Implementation Support and Upgrades
ERP systems require continuous monitoring, updates, and optimizations after implementation:
- Ongoing Support: Ensure the vendor offers adequate post-implementation support to troubleshoot issues and provide upgrades as needed.
- User Training: A well-trained team is essential for successful ERP adoption. Ensure ongoing training and resources are available for your staff.
Conclusion
Choosing the right ERP system is a complex but critical decision that can significantly impact your business’s efficiency and growth. By carefully assessing your business needs, evaluating vendors, and considering long-term scalability, you can select an ERP solution that aligns with your objectives and positions your company for future success. Take your time to research, consult with stakeholders, and partner with an experienced vendor to ensure a smooth and successful ERP implementation.